Norway’s sovereign wealth fund has signaled its support for Metaplanet’s management proposals, including the company’s Bitcoin-focused treasury strategy.
The fund, managed by Norges Bank Investment Management (NBIM), holds roughly 0.3% of Metaplanet’s shares as of the end of June 2025.
The proposals are scheduled for a shareholder vote on December 22, 2025, a decision that could shape the next phase of Metaplanet’s capital strategy.

Shareholder Endorsement Of Management Direction
NBIM’s backing applies to Metaplanet’s broader management agenda and effectively endorses the company’s approach to holding Bitcoin as a treasury asset. While the stake itself is relatively small, support from one of the world’s largest sovereign wealth funds carries symbolic weight.
The move reflects growing institutional comfort with corporate strategies that incorporate Bitcoin exposure through balance-sheet allocations.
Indirect Bitcoin Exposure Through Equities
Norway’s sovereign wealth fund has consistently favored indirect exposure to Bitcoin rather than holding the asset outright. In addition to Metaplanet, the fund has previously invested in companies such as MicroStrategy, which use equity structures to provide economic exposure to Bitcoin price movements.
This approach allows large institutions to gain Bitcoin-linked exposure while remaining within traditional equity investment frameworks.
Part Of A Broader Institutional Trend
NBIM’s position aligns with a wider trend among sovereign wealth funds and institutional investors. Rather than directly holding digital assets, many are choosing equity stakes in companies that operate Bitcoin treasury strategies.
This method offers regulatory clarity, operational familiarity, and easier portfolio integration compared to direct custody of cryptocurrencies.
Shareholder Vote Could Shape Capital Expansion
The upcoming December 22 shareholder meeting is seen as a key moment for Metaplanet. Approval of the proposals would allow the company to proceed with plans to issue preferred shares, raising capital to significantly expand its Bitcoin holdings.
The outcome of the vote will determine how aggressively Metaplanet can pursue its treasury strategy moving into 2026, with backing from institutional shareholders providing additional credibility to the plan.
